We recently bought a 94 T139. We bought it for the weight. I didn't realize that there was no gray water tank. I can live with that as long as I get a site with sewer, otherwise we can't use the sink or shower? I guess that means no boondocking. On our first outing we put our bedding inside the bathroom and when we went to prepare our bed we found out the water had backed into the shower and ruined pillows and so on.
I took off the shower drain screen and installed a rubber sink stopper.
When we bought the trailer there was an adapter on the gray water drain that allowed a garden hose to be connected for draining. The next time we were out (with brand new pillows) we washed the dishes and when draining the sink, the water came out the plumbing vent on the outside of the trailer.
I am losing my enthusiasm for this little trailer and wondered if there is someone out there with similar issues?
